March Weather in Whitefish, United States

Last updated: February 24, 2025

In March, Whitefish, United States experiences a dynamic climate characterized by cold temperatures and consistent precipitation. The month sees a maximum temperature reaching 16°C (60°F), while the average hovers around a brisk -1°C (30°F), with minimum lows plunging to -27°C (-17°F). Residents can expect 71 mm (2.8 in) of precipitation over 16 days, contributing to a notably humid environment averaging 88% humidity. March Precipitation in Whitefish

March in Whitefish brings a moderate precipitation total of 71 mm (2.8 in), falling slightly below the monthly averages seen in both January and February. This month marks a transition from the winter's heavier snows to the more varied spring showers, with rain falling over 16 days, mirroring February’s frequency. While March’s totals reflect a noticeable dip compared to February’s 95 mm (3.7 in), the weather sets the stage for the upcoming seasonal shifts, paving the way for April’s increase to 91 mm (3.6 in). March Humidity in Whitefish

March in Whitefish, United States, marks a noticeable shift in humidity levels, with humidity decreasing to 88% from the previous months' high averages. Following a rather damp winter, where January and February boasted humidity levels of 93% and 91% respectively, March offers a hint of relief as the air begins to dry out slightly. As the region transitions into spring, this gradual decline sets the tone for the forthcoming months, with April seeing a further drop to 84%. U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.

Daylight Hours in Whitefish in March

As winter gives way to spring, March in Whitefish heralds a noticeable increase in daylight duration, reaching 11 hours. This marks a significant leap from the 10 hours seen in February, setting the stage for longer, sunnier days ahead.
